Transaction 28ec689d8307bd22b8592697feec11b4ba8dac3001b2da598aa15bb3329f492e
1 Input
1 Output
-
28ec689d8307bd22b8592697feec11b4ba8dac3001b2da598aa15bb3329f492e:0
- value
- 8668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a3bc6d8207ff6d81cbd4a29063a4cc53b462fd0 OP_EQUAL
- address
- 3QW8TrwA5p6ZRPJjkvHrBWh9y1EbKJaz2G